Let K = \mathbb Q(√(-q)), where q is a prime congruent to 3 modulo 4. Let A = A(q) denote the Gross curve over the Hilbert class field H of K. In this note we use Magma to calculate the values L(E/H, 1) for all such q's up to some reasonable ranges for all primes q congruent to 7 modulo 8. All these values are non-zero, and using the Birch and Swinnerton-Dyer conjecture, we can calculate hypothetical orders of the Tate-Shafarevich group of A for all such q up to 4831.
